Abdessamad Kayouh is the recently appointed Minister of Transport and Logistics in Morocco, recognized for his commitment to enhancing road safety. During the fourth World Conference on Road Safety held in Marrakech, he emphasized the need for high-quality helmets for motorcyclists and announced that each purchase of a two-wheeler or three-wheeler would include two certified helmets. His focus on collaborative efforts and the adoption of the Marrakech Declaration highlights his dedication to reducing road fatalities and promoting safety measures across the country.
